About the Arches
The Arches Studios is a managed visual arts studio complex of 27 studios, for visual artists at all stages of their careers and working across all media, in which artistic practice can flourish.
The studios offer a vibrant environment where artists can develop their visual arts practice, contribute towards the creative community, engage with a programme of development activities and participate in an annual Open Studios event where the public are welcomed into the studios.
In addition to your personal studio, residents have free access to book other spaces for workshops alongside using the 7.5m project space for small-scale exhibitions. There is also a communal kitchen, meeting area and storage area as well as 24/7 access and wifi.
We aim to make the studios affordable and all residents benefit from discretionary rate relief passed on by ‘a space’ arts, the charity operating the studios.
Please note: as the studios benefit from discretionary rate relief, the Arches studios can not offer affordable studios to support commercial creative business activity or currently enrolled students. Please contact us before making an application if you are unsure about the commerciality of your business.
Price bands range between £87 to £147 p/m and are all inclusive.
Applications Process
*Please note: All the studio spaces are currently full, but please send your application in, to be added to the studio waiting list.
Studio spaces are awarded following an application and interview process, with applications assessed by the charity’s staff and a representative from the studio residents. If you wish to apply for a studio please download and complete the application form.
Artists are assessed according to the following criteria:
• A commitment to an ongoing visual arts practice
• A clear vision for the development of their work
• An engagement with the wider visual arts context
• How a studio space will benefit the applicant’s practice
• A willingness to make an active contribution to the Arches community
